Abstract

The present application belongs to the technical field of cigarette production, and discloses a cigarette band detection method, a cigarette band detection device and a cigarette production system. The method comprises the following steps: obtaining images of a first image part and a second image part; obtaining a first concentration value and a second concentration value according to the first image part and the second image part; determining whether the first concentration value and the second concentration value are within a minimum threshold value of printing concentration and a maximum threshold value of printing concentration; if not, determining that the cigarette band is unqualified; if yes, further obtaining a deviation value representing the concentration difference between the first image part and the second image part; determining whether the deviation value is within a minimum threshold value of printing concentration difference and a maximum threshold value of printing concentration difference; if yes, determining that the cigarette band printing is qualified; if not, determining that the cigarette band printing is unqualified. The cigarette band detection device applies the above method. The cigarette production system comprises the above device. The cigarette band detection method can detect cigarette bands with "yin and yang surfaces", and improve the qualification rate of cigarette bands.

[0001] The present invention relates to the technical field of cigarette production, and particularly to a method and device for detecting a cigarette steel seal and a cigarette production system. Background Art

[0002] Currently, cigarette papers of cigarettes are generally printed with cigarette steel seals, and the cigarette steel seals can have information on the production batches of cigarettes and can also be used to distinguish the authenticity of cigarettes.

[0003] In related technologies, there is a device for detecting a cigarette steel seal, which needs to import a qualified cigarette steel seal image as a template, record the image of the cigarette produced online, and compare the similarity with the template image. Among them, a maximum threshold and a minimum threshold for the concentration of the cigarette steel seal are generally set during the detection process. When the overall concentration of the cigarette steel seal is within the range of the maximum threshold and the minimum threshold, it is considered to have a high similarity with the template image, and it is determined that the printing of the cigarette steel seal is qualified according to the concentration index. Otherwise, it is considered that the difference from the template image is too large and is determined to be unqualified.

[0004] However, this judgment method can only ensure that the overall concentration of the cigarette steel seal meets the requirements, but there will still be some cigarette steel seals with "yin-yang surfaces", that is, the concentration on one side of the cigarette steel seal is too light and the concentration on the other side is too deep. For example, one of the two ear of wheat parts symmetrical to the cigarette steel seal is too light and the other is too deep. Such cigarette steel seals also do not meet the requirements in appearance and affect the qualification rate of batches of cigarettes. Therefore, how to further screen out the cigarette steel seals with "yin-yang surfaces" and ensure the qualification rate of cigarettes has become the direction of efforts of technicians in the field. [0048] This embodiment provides a method for detecting the cigarette brand mark. Refer to Figures 1 to 3 As shown, the method for detecting the cigarette brand mark is used to detect the printing quality of the cigarette brand mark. The cigarette brand mark is printed on the cigarette, and the cigarette brand mark has a first image part 01 and a second image part 02.

[0049] Exemplarily, refer to Figure 2 As shown, in this embodiment, the first image part 01 and the second image part 02 respectively correspond to two wheat ear spike parts symmetrically arranged on the cigarette brand mark.

[0050] Continue to refer to Figures 1 to 3 As shown, the method for detecting the cigarette brand mark mainly includes the following steps:

[0051] S100. Obtain images of the first image part 01 and the second image part 02.

[0052] S200. Obtain A value and B value according to the first image part 01 and the second image part 02; where A is the first concentration value corresponding to the first image part 01, and B is the second concentration value corresponding to the second image part 02.

[0053] S300. Judge whether A and B satisfy: S1 < A < S2 and S1 < B < S2; where S1 is the minimum threshold of the printing concentration of a qualified cigarette brand mark, and S2 is the maximum threshold of the printing concentration of a qualified cigarette brand mark;

[0054] If so, perform step S400; if not, judge that the printing of the cigarette brand mark is unqualified.

[0055] S400. Obtain a deviation value C according to A and B, and C is used to characterize the concentration difference between the first image part 01 and the second image part 02;

[0056] S500. Judge whether C satisfies: S3 < C < S4; where S3 is the minimum threshold of the printing concentration difference of a qualified cigarette brand mark, and S4 is the maximum threshold of the printing concentration difference of a qualified cigarette brand mark;

[0057] If so, judge that the printing of the cigarette brand mark is qualified; if not, judge that the printing of the cigarette brand mark is unqualified.

[0058] In this embodiment, images of the first image portion 01 and the second image portion 02 on the cigarette stamp are first acquired. A first concentration value A is obtained from the image of the first image portion 01, and a second concentration value B is obtained from the image of the second image portion 02. It is then determined whether A and B satisfy S1 < A < S2 and S1 < B < S2, that is, whether A and B are both within the threshold range of the minimum printing concentration threshold S1 and the maximum printing concentration threshold S2. If the determination is negative at this step, it indicates that the overall concentration of the cigarette stamp does not meet the printing requirements, and the printing is deemed unqualified. If the determination is positive, it indicates that the overall concentration of the cigarette stamp meets the requirements, and then it is further determined whether the cigarette stamp has a "yin-yang" phenomenon. Specifically, a deviation value C that can characterize the concentration difference between the first image portion 01 and the second image portion 02 is obtained from A and B, and it is determined whether C satisfies S3 < C < S4, that is, whether C is within the threshold range of the minimum printing concentration difference threshold S3 and the maximum printing concentration difference threshold S4. If the determination is yes, it indicates that the density difference between the first image unit 01 and the second image unit 02 meets the threshold requirement, and the cigarette stamp printing is deemed qualified. If the determination is no, it indicates that the density difference between the first image unit 01 and the second image unit 02 is too large, meaning the cigarette stamp is a "yin-yang" stamp, and the cigarette stamp is deemed unqualified. This method can further filter out "yin-yang" cigarette stamps, avoiding situations where one side of the cigarette stamp has too light a density and the other side has too dark a density, thus improving the pass rate of cigarette stamps.

[0059] For example, with Figure 2 Taking the cigarette stamp as an example, in addition to the first image unit 01 and the second image unit 02, it also includes a third image unit 03, a fourth image unit 04, and a fifth image unit 05. Specifically, the third image unit 03 corresponds to the upper half of the text on the cigarette stamp, the fourth image unit 04 corresponds to the lower half of the text on the cigarette stamp, and the fifth image unit 05 corresponds to the numerical serial number portion of the cigarette stamp. The third image unit 03, the fourth image unit 04, and the fifth image unit 05 can also be applied to the method described above to achieve concentration detection and "yin-yang" detection. For example, concentration comparison can be achieved between the third image unit 03 and the fourth image unit 04, or concentration comparison can be achieved between the first image unit 01 and the fifth image unit 05.

[0060] For example, the minimum printing density threshold S1 is preferably set to 20, and the maximum printing density threshold S2 is preferably set to 450. Specifically, if it is determined that A and B satisfy 20 < A < 450 and 20 < B < 450, it indicates that the overall density of the cigarette stamp meets the requirements; otherwise, it indicates that the overall density of the cigarette stamp does not meet the printing requirements.

[0061] For example, the minimum threshold value S1 for the printing density difference is preferably set to -350, and the maximum threshold value S2 for the printing density difference is preferably set to 350. Specifically, if it is determined that C satisfies -350 < C < 350, it indicates that the density difference between the first image unit 01 and the second image unit 02 meets the threshold requirement, and the cigarette stamp printing is deemed qualified; if it is determined otherwise, it indicates that the density difference between the first image unit 01 and the second image unit 02 is too large, that is, the cigarette stamp is a "yin-yang" stamp, and the cigarette stamp is deemed unqualified.

[0062] In this embodiment, in step S100, both the first concentration value A and the second concentration value B are binarized values.

[0063] In this embodiment, in step S400, the value of C is obtained by the following formula:

[0064] When A < B, C = ABD;

[0065] When A > B, C = A - B + D;

[0066] Where D is the compensation constant, and D > 0.

[0067] Specifically, when A < B, AB is negative, and we need to subtract D to get the corresponding C. When A > B, AB is positive, and we need to add D to get the corresponding C.

[0068] For example, the value of D is set to 150. The value of D is adaptively set according to the process control requirements such as the size, color, and concentration of the cigarette stamp.

[0069] In this embodiment, when the cigarette stamp is determined to be unqualified, the cigarettes containing the unqualified cigarette stamp are rejected.

[0070] This embodiment also provides a cigarette stamp detection device, which applies the above-described cigarette stamp detection method. The cigarette stamp detection device includes a recording device 1, a visual inspection device 2, a rejection device 3, and a controller 4.

[0071] in,

[0072] The recording device 1 is communicatively connected to the visual inspection device 2, and both the visual inspection device 2 and the rejection device 3 are communicatively connected to the controller 4. The recording device 1 is used to record images of cigarette stamps containing a first image part 01 and a second image part 02 on the cigarettes, and sends the images of the cigarette stamps to the visual inspection device 2. The visual inspection device 2 is used to detect the printing quality of the cigarette stamps based on the recorded images of the cigarette stamps, and sends the detection results to the controller 4. The controller 4 is adapted to control the rejection device 3 to reject the corresponding cigarettes after receiving a detection result indicating that the cigarette stamps are unqualified.

[0073] In this embodiment, the cigarette stamp inspection device applies the above-described cigarette stamp inspection method. The recording device 1 captures an image of the cigarette stamp containing the first image portion 01 and the second image portion 02 on the cigarette, and sends the image to the vision inspection device 2. The vision inspection device 2 performs steps such as acquiring the first concentration value A and the second concentration value B, comparing A and B with S1 and S2 respectively, acquiring the deviation value C, and comparing C with S3 and S4 to detect the printing quality of the cigarette stamp, thereby determining whether the cigarette stamp is qualified. Furthermore, the controller 4 controls the rejection device 3 to reject the corresponding cigarette, ensuring the pass rate of cigarettes on the production line.

[0074] For example, the recording device 1 is configured as a color high-speed camera.

[0075] For example, controller 4 is configured as PLC controller 4.

[0076] For example, the rejection device 3 can be configured as a rejection cylinder or as a mechanical gripper.

[0077] Furthermore, the cigarette stamp detection device also includes a lighting device 5, which provides illumination to the recording device 1. This ensures that the recording device 1 has sufficient light during image acquisition, thereby guaranteeing the quality of the captured images.

[0078] For example, the lighting device 5 is configured as an LED light source.

[0079] Furthermore, the cigarette stamp detection device also includes a pulse sensor 6, and both the pulse sensor 6 and the lighting device 5 are communicatively connected to the controller 4. The pulse sensor 6 is adapted to send a signal to the controller 4 when a cigarette passes through the recording area of ​​the recording device 1, causing the controller 4 to control the recording device 1 to record, and simultaneously control the lighting device 5 to operate. Specifically, the pulse sensor 6 is used as a trigger signal to trigger image capture. When the pulse sensor 6 emits a trigger pulse, the signal is input to the controller 4. This causes the controller 4 to control the lighting device 5 to turn on once, providing a light source for capturing the cigarette stamp, and then the controller 4 controls the recording device 1 to take one image.

[0080] Furthermore, the cigarette stamp inspection device also includes a display device 7, which is communicatively connected to the vision inspection device 2. The display device 7 is used to display images of unqualified cigarette stamps. This allows operators to observe the causes of unqualified cigarette stamps in real time, adaptively adjust the printing process, and improve the printing quality of subsequent batches.

[0081] This embodiment also provides a cigarette production system, including the aforementioned cigarette stamp detection device. The cigarette production system further includes a conveyor belt and a cigarette printing roller. The conveyor belt is used to transport cigarettes, the recording device 1 is located above the conveyor belt, and the cigarette printing roller is located above the conveyor belt for printing cigarette stamps on the cigarettes transported on the conveyor belt.

[0082] Specifically, there is a recording position along the conveyor belt's conveying direction, and the recording device 1 is located at the recording position. When the conveyor belt conveys a cigarette to the area below the recording device 1 and enters the recording area, the controller 4 controls the recording device 1 to perform recording via the pulse sensor 6, and simultaneously controls the lighting device 5 to operate.

[0083] For example, in this embodiment, multiple cigarette printing rollers may be provided, each used for printing cigarette stamps of different colors.

[0084] Furthermore, the cigarette production system also includes multiple conveyor rollers rotatably mounted on the frame, with a conveyor belt wound around these rollers. Specifically, the rotation of the conveyor rollers drives the conveyor belt to perform the conveying operation.

[0085] The cigarette production system provided in this embodiment includes the above-mentioned cigarette stamp detection device. The conveyor belt transports cigarettes to the camera 1, so that the camera 1 captures the image of the cigarette stamp and performs the above-mentioned detection work, detecting cigarette stamps with "yin-yang sides" printed on the cigarettes, thereby improving the pass rate of cigarette stamps.
